How can I give a stock certificate gift to someone?

To give a stock certificate gift to someone, you can purchase shares of a company in their name through a brokerage firm. Once the purchase is complete, you can request a physical stock certificate from the company's transfer agent and then present it as a gift to the recipient.

What is the difference between grants and options in terms of employee compensation?

Grants are typically given as a form of stock or equity to employees, while options give employees the right to buy stock at a set price in the future. Grants are usually given as a gift, while options require the employee to purchase the stock.

What is differce between share and stock?

"Share" refers to a single unit of ownership in a company, while "stock" encompasses all the ownership interests in a company held by its shareholders. Essentially, a share is a part of the stock, which represents the total ownership stake in the company."

Does stock dividend increase owner's equity?

No, all it does is give each shareholder more shares but each share is of proportionately less value. Net-net, the only impact is to reduce share price.
